The National Climatic Data Center (NCDC) in Asheville, North Carolina is the world's largest active archive of weather data.
According to the NCDC, each of the years from 1997-2009 represent the warmest global temperatures on record, dating back to
1880. Which of these would represent a biased conclusion based on this data?
A)
the data only dates back to the 1880's
B)
the average global temperature for 2007 as 58.00 °F
C)
the warmest year on record was 2005 and the coolest was 1911
D)
the automobile industry is solely to blame for the increase in global
temperatures


Sagot :

Answer:

D) the automobile industry is solely to blame for the increase in global

temperatures

Explanation:

that is based because many things cause global warming, not just the exhaust from cars.
